VLSI architecture for Reliability based soft decision decoding of turbo codes for satellite communication

This work is focused on hardware design of Soft Decision Decoders (SSD) that use channel output information as reliability measures to improve the coding gain with associated levels of complexity. The project is geared towards FPGA implementation of the reliability based SSD for Turbo codes to suit deep space applications.
